This annual report provides an overview of major results and progress on research and development activities at Fusion Research and Development Directorate for FY2008 and FY2009. Concerning the ITER project, JAEA was nominated as the domestic agency by the Japanese government after the ITER Agreement took effect, and has fulfilled the obligations. In the development of superconducting conductors, JAEA immediately started and completed the construction of a plant to fabricate superconducting conductors, and started their fabrication ahead of other countries. For the Broader Approach (BA) activities, JAEA was designated as the implementing agency by the Japanese government after the BA Agreement took effect, and has fulfilled the obligations and promoted three projects in the BA activities steadily through domestic cooperation and coordination with Europe.

This annual report provides an overview of major results and progress on research and development activities at Fusion Research and Development Directorate of Japan Atomic Energy Agency (JAEA) from April 1, 2007 to March 31, 2008, including those performed in collaboration with other directorates of JAEA, research institutes, and universities. In October 2007, ITER Agreements entered into force and JAEA was designated as the Japanese Domestic Agency by Japanese Government. In June 2007, JAEA was assigned as the Implementing Agency for the Broader Approach Activities. The JT-60U operation regime was extended toward the long sustainment of high normalized beta () with good confinement (). In fusion reactor technologies, a steady state operation of the 170 GHz gyrotron up to 800 s with 1 MW was demonstrated for ITER. In addition, theoretical and analytical researches on fusion plasmas and design study on DEMO reactor were progressed substantially.
